Aristocrat Gaming has announced the first rollout of its NFL-themed slot portfolio outside of the continental United States of America in Puerto Rico.

The global designer, manufacturer, and distributor of land-based slot and electronic games will distribute NFL Triple Score to 13 casinos on the Jackpot del Encanto link in Puerto Rico. 

The NFL Tripe Score slot is available on gaming floors alongside Jackpot del Encanto, which is a program featuring select slot machines in participating casinos across the island. It features a progressive jackpot, beginning at $20,000 and increasing as more people take part. 

Aristocrat has outlined that the game is on the MarsX Portrait Cabinet, and modeled after the ‘wildly successful’ Bao Zhu Zhao Fu game family. The game features 32-team graphics, symbols and NFL game footage, exclusive to Aristocrat through its licensing arrangement with the Football League. 

Craig Toner, CEO of Aristocrat Gaming, commented, “This launch is a major step forward in continuing our successful partnership with the NFL. The NFL has immense popularity globally with fans all across the world, and we are thrilled to now bring the game to a broader stage. We look forward to seeing the excitement from players in Puerto Rico and continuing the success our award-winning NFL portfolio has seen in North America.”

The company plans to continue its rollout beyond the shores of continental America, with LATAM and Europe earmarked for future releases. 

Could NFL-based slots head to the UAE? 

In October 2024, Aristocrat Gaming became the first international slot company to be granted a gaming-related vendor license by the United Arab Emirates’ General Commercial Gaming Regulatory Authority (GCGRA).

The license allows the Australia-headquartered company to provide its hardware and services and gaming content through its gaming machines, as well as online games and technology, to other commercial gaming operators who have received a license from the regulator.

Aristocrat Gaming has been approved to do business in the United Arab Emirates after being granted a gaming-related vendor licence by the country’s gambling regulator General Commercial Gaming Regulatory Authority (GCGRA).

The firm has stated that it is the first international slot and online technology company to be granted a gaming-related vendor licence by GCGRA, following its establishment last year.

With its licence, Aristocrat will provide its gaming content, hardware and services in the UAE, offering its land-based electronic gaming machines, online games and technology solutions to GCGRA-licensed commercial gaming operators.  

Hector Fernandez, CEO of Gaming for Aristocrat, commented: “We are honoured to be the first large, international technology provider to be awarded a gaming-related vendor licence to serve the UAE market. 

“At Aristocrat, our vision is to deliver the best seat in the house wherever, and whenever the world plays. We look forward to doing so by providing premium content for players in the UAE while simultaneously encouraging responsible gameplay.”

Aristocrat isn’t the only company with a licence in the UAE, as earlier this month, Wynn Resorts announced it had been awarded a commercial gaming operator licence in the country for its upcoming Wynn Al Marjan Island resort in Ras Al Khaimah (RAK).

Wynn Resorts has been developing and constructing a resort at Wynn Al Marjan Island in RAK over the past year as part of a joint venture between affiliates of Wynn Resorts, Marjan and RAK Hospitality Holding.

The operator has also outlined its financial forecasts for its upcoming Wynn Al Marjan Island resort, where it projects gross gaming revenue (GGR) of up to $1.66bn.

MGM Resorts also has an interest in the UAE, as the operator submitted a formal application for a casino license in Abu Dhabi back in September.

Furthermore, according to Global Investments, analysts at Morgan Stanley have recently underpinned just how lucrative the UAE’s gaming market could be. 

Morgan Stanley has predicted that the region’s GGR could total up to $5bn annually, drawing comparisons to Singapore as the investment bank believes the UAE can rival or even exceed that market.

Aristocrat Gaming is hoping to capture the excitement of House of the Dragon fans after announcing the launch of a new cabinet game using IP from the HBO show. 

The slot game – titled House of the Dragon – will be installed on Aristocrat’s King Max cabinet as part of the supplier’s existing partnership with Warner Bros, making the announcement ahead of the Game of Thrones prequel series’ second season finale on Sunday, August 4. 

Aristocrat’s official partnership with Warner Bros has seen the supplier produce previous Games of Thrones slot cabinets, having released ‘Games of Thrones Winter is Here’ back in 2021.  

“The House of the Dragon television series has broken records and engaged a legacy of fans in a new way,” said Hector Fernandez, CEO of Aristocrat Gaming.

“We are thrilled to further the epic entertainment of this hit series with the creation of the new House of the Dragon slot game. 

“We are proud of the previous successes we’ve had bringing our Game of Thrones slot games to life, and we anticipate this new game to continue the excitement and appeal to an even larger audience.”

The House of the Dragon slot will be showcased for the first time in the Aristocrat Gaming booth this October at the upcoming Global Gaming Expo in Las Vegas.

Aristocrat Gaming has formed a multi-year partnership with the Dallas Cowboys for a series of NFL-focused collaborations. 

The igaming supplier will benefit from the partnership by gaining prominent signage throughout Cowboys’ AT&T Stadium year-round, including in-stadium, on the concourse and in-game branding. 

Additional elements within the partnership include in-game promotions, digital integrations and game-day activations at the Cowboys’ stadium.

Hector Fernandez, CEO of Aristocrat Gaming, commented: “We are proud to be the newest partner of the Dallas Cowboys, one of the world’s premier sports and entertainment organisations with a proud championed history, much like Aristocrat Gaming.

“With the success of the NFL Slots portfolio, we have been able to bring the excitement of fan-favourite teams like the Dallas Cowboys to casino floors across the country. We look forward to bringing even more innovative experiences to fans through this partnership.”

Aristocrat has deepened its relationship with NFL fans through this deal, having previously established a multi-year slot licensing agreement with the league. 

In collaboration with the NFL, Aristocrat produced NFL-themed slot machines that are available in casinos across the US, allowing players to select their favourite teams, including the Cowboys, to engage with the slot. 

Chad Estis, Executive Vice President of Business Operations of the Dallas Cowboys, added: “The Cowboys are excited to partner with Aristocrat Gaming to bring even more ways to entertain our fans.

“We pride ourselves on aligning with world-class partners, and Aristocrat Gaming has been a trailblazer in the gaming industry for decades. We are thrilled to work with the Aristocrat team on activation and branding opportunities throughout the year and to have our Cowboys marks featured on their slot machines nationwide.”

Aristocrat Gaming has unveiled its line of NFL-branded slot machines with the launch of NFL Super Bowl Jackpots, releasing the land-based title as the NFL season begins on September 8. 

Having announced the collaboration with an official licensing agreement formed in 2021, Aristocrat Gaming has developed a series of NFL-themed games to ‘bring the largest sports brand in the U.S. to casino floors across the country’. 

“Today, we are thrilled to debut the first look of the new NFL-licensed slot machines, which will provide an innovative entertainment experience for millions of NFL fans who enjoy the fun of casino gaming,” commented Hector Fernandez, CEO of Aristocrat Gaming. 

“We are changing the game with this first-of-its-kind slot machine, offering fans the ability to customise the experience by selecting their favourite team in any casino they choose to play.”  

Hosted on Aristocrat’s new King Max cabinet, NFL Super Bowl Jackpots is the first instalment of the collaboration, with several other games set to be released over time as part of the multi-year partnership. 

With the game, fans of the NFL will be able to experience gameplay features such as six licenced stadium anthems that play during key moments, as well as gaining the chance to win a $1m progressive jackpot. 

Other games set to be released later this year or in 2024 through the collaboration include Overtime Cash, Super Bowl Link, NFL Kickoff, Winning Drive and Rings of Victory.

“The unveiling of the first NFL-themed slot machines represents an opportunity to bring the League closer to our fans in a new area,” added Joe Ruggiero, SVP of Consumer Products at the NFL. 

“We have valued collaborating with Aristocrat to bring their vision and responsible gaming resources to fans during the 2023 NFL season and beyond.”

Aristocrat Gaming has agreed to become the official slot machines of the Formula One Las Vegas Grand Prix via a multi-year sponsorship deal.

The F1 Heineken Silver Las Vegas Grand Prix is set to take place on the Las Vegas Strip later this year from November 16-18.

Several casinos along the Strip are partners with the F1 race, including founding partners Caesars Entertainment, MGM Resorts International and Wynn Las Vegas, as well as presenting partners MSG Sphere, Resorts World Las Vegas, and The Venetian Resort.

“Las Vegas is widely known for world-class entertainment, hospitality experiences and slot gaming, which is why we are thrilled to be the official slot machines of the F1 Heineken Silver Las Vegas Grand Prix,” commented Mark Wadley, Chief Marketing Officer of Aristocrat Gaming.

“This event will be like no other and we look forward to inviting interested F1 fans to play our great lineup of entertaining slot games that match the excitement on the track.”

Aristocrat Gaming’s partnerships within the sports world spread beyond F1, as the company also has a slot machines deal with the NFL and is the official partner of the Las Vegas Raiders and Allegiant Stadium.

Emily Prazer, Chief Commercial Officer for the Formula 1 Heineken Silver Las Vegas Grand Prix, added: “Introducing the F1 experience to a new city, it was crucial to partner with a local brand that shares our mission to enhance the guest experience through innovation and technology, and also understands Las Vegas’ unique market.

“Aristocrat aligns perfectly with our values and vision for the 2023 race, and we are excited for the start of what we believe will be a seamless partnership.”

A first cashless gaming trial is to commence in the Australian state of New South Wales today (Monday 10 October), with the maiden test seeing Aristocrat Gaming tech be installed at Wests Newcastle.

With up to 200 members able to utilise the offering, which includes features to reduce risks of gambling harm and to protect against money laundering, Kevin Anderson, minister for Hospitality and Racing, suggested that the three-month evaluation intends to assess benefits for venues and patrons.

Examples of limits that can be set using the technology include session length, frequency of play, total net expenditure in a given period and maximum total bets within a specific time frame.

Furthermore, users can choose which of these limits to activate, and can choose multiple limits which cannot then be altered for 24 hours.

“The trial is part of an exciting new era where innovations such as digital wallets offer customers greater convenience and control over their spending and help venues and authorities identify suspected cases of money laundering,” Anderson said.

“Technology developed by Aristocrat Gaming has been installed on 36 of the Wests club’s gaming machines using Bluetooth to connect patrons’ mobile phones to machines.

“The technology will allow for a Bluetooth connection between a patron’s mobile phone and the machine. This will let patrons transfer money directly from the gaming wallet on their phone onto the machine.

“The digital wallet can be used to fund gaming machine play and players can set spending or time limits, access real-time spending data, take a break or self-exclude from gambling and access other responsible gambling tools and services. Patrons cannot load funds into the gaming wallet from the gaming floor.

“The digital wallet requires a person’s identity to be confirmed before they can play and they are linked to that person’s debit card or bank account which means authorities can identify where those funds have come from if needed.”

David Ronson, Managing Director Aristocrat Gaming APAC, added that the investment in cashless payment solutions, through digital wallet tech, comes as the group aims to “deliver a complete digital experience for patrons”.

“This trial builds on our long-standing commitment to patron choice, and welfare,” said Phil Gardner, CEO of The Wests Group Australia.

“We know many of our patrons want the convenience of digital payments, which is part of this trial. The trial also allows us to offer a powerful new suite of digital tools to empower our members and allow them to set limits, speak to a staff member, or even exclude themselves from the club if they choose.”

Furthermore, it was also noted that the government has also approved three other gaming manufacturers to conduct similar trials, with a further application currently being assessed.

“The trials will explore different technologies and solutions to enable cashless gaming play in NSW, and trial important harm minimisation measures which will help individuals to take greater control of their gambling,” Anderson ended.

Aristocrat is looking to take its gaming division “to the next level” after confirming a pair of appointments to maintain its leadership team expansion.

This has seen Deanne McKissick be named Chief Supply Chain Officer, with Mark Wadley becoming Chief Marketing Officer of Aristocrat Gaming.

Reporting to Hector Fernandez, CEO of Aristocrat Gaming, the former will be tasked with managing the entire global supply chain in a bid to ensure that customers “continue to have the best product purchasing experience”.

McKissick most recently served as the Senior Vice President of Americas Supply Chain and Customer Order Execution, managing sales support, configuration and order change, material oversight, dual site manufacturing, and quality and customer delivery coordination.

Elsewhere, Wadley will oversee all marketing efforts at a global level as the company voices an aim of maximising the value of the gaming division and products.

Previously, he was the Senior Vice President of Marketing, responsible for marketing strategy, branding and partnerships for the Americas Region

“As we continue to focus on changing the game, our superb talent is a core component of our ability to lead the market,” said Fernandez. 

“Deanne and Mark’s backgrounds lend a unique perspective to help take our business to the next level. We are delighted to welcome both to the global gaming leadership team where they will continue to inspire our employees, vendors, partners and customers to reach new heights.”

In May, Aristocrat reaffirmed that it was pursuing opportunities to accelerate its ‘build and buy’ real money gaming strategy as the group looks to become the “leading gaming platform” across the industry.

This blueprint was first detailed earlier in the year and is to see Aristocrat “invest strongly” in building its online RMG infrastructure while pursuing M&A, partnerships and talent acquisition to drive its ambitions forward further still.

Aristocrat is pursuing opportunities to accelerate its ‘build and buy’ real money gaming strategy as the group looks to become the “leading gaming platform” across the industry.

This blueprint was first detailed earlier in the year and is to see Aristocrat “invest strongly” in building its online RMG infrastructure while pursuing M&A, partnerships and talent acquisition to drive its ambitions forward further still.

This comes as the company details a 23.1 per cent uptick in operating revenue during the six months ending March 31, 2022, to A$2.74bn (2021: A$2.22bn), driven by organic growth across Aristocrat Gaming and Pixel United, formerly the group’s digital division. 

Normalised profit after tax increased 46.5 per cent to A$530.7m (2021: A$362.2m)  despite mixed operating conditions and supply chain disruptions, with EBITDA up 30.3 per cent to A$970.3m (2021: A$744.5m).

Trevor Croker, Aristocrat Chief Executive Officer and Managing Director, explained: “Aristocrat delivered an impressive and resilient performance despite mixed operational conditions and challenges. 

“We took comprehensive action to protect our people and business, while investing strongly to accelerate our growth strategy going forward.

“Our sustained investment in talent, technology and product enables us to continue to take share wherever we play and delivered significant top and bottom-line growth in the first half of fiscal 2022

“We are accelerating the implementation of our ‘build and buy’ strategy to scale in online real money gaming, which provides further channels for us to distribute our world-leading content. 

“Our ambition is to be the leading gaming platform in the global online RMG industry, and we anticipate being live with igaming products in two jurisdictions in the US by the end of calendar year 2022.” 

For the full-year to September 30, 2022, Aristocrat anticipates further investment to drive sustained, long-term growth, which it says will likely fall above the historic range of 11 per cent to 12 per cent of revenue. Further expenditure is also expected to support the ongoing RMG strategy.

“We continue to make progress in our sustainability efforts, including our commitment to responsible gameplay, and to adopting a group-wide science-based emissions reduction target by the end of calendar year 2023,” Croker added.

“Aristocrat enters the second half with excellent fundamentals and strong operational momentum, a robust balance sheet and an abundance of opportunity to accelerate our growth strategy.”
